Linux 中执行 shell 脚本的多种方式及具体方法分享
原创
Linux 中执行 Shell 脚本的多种方法及具体方法
在Linux系统中,执行Shell脚本有多种方法。以下是一些常用的方法及其具体步骤。
方法一:直接运行脚本
如果脚本文件具有执行权限,可以直接运行脚本。首先,给脚本文件赋予执行权限:
chmod +x script.sh
然后,使用以下命令运行脚本:
./script.sh
方法二:使用bash命令
如果不想给脚本文件赋予执行权限,可以使用bash命令来执行脚本:
bash script.sh
方法三:使用source命令
当你需要在当前环境中执行脚本,并期待脚本的变量和函数在当前环境中生效时,可以使用source命令:
source script.sh
方法四:通过绝对路径执行脚本
如果知道脚本的绝对路径,可以使用绝对路径执行脚本:
/path/to/script.sh
注意:在这种情况下,脚本文件也需要具有执行权限。
方法五:使用sh命令
除了使用bash命令执行脚本外,还可以使用sh命令:
sh script.sh
在某些系统中,sh大概是指向bash或其他Shell的软链接。故而,这种方法在某些情况下大概同样适用。
总结
在Linux系统中执行Shell脚本有多种方法,可以通过实际情况和需求选择合适的方法。需要注意的是,无论使用哪种方法,都要确保脚本文件具有执行权限。